Microsoft Corporation $MSFT Shares Sold by Leeward Financial Partners LLC

Leeward Financial Partners LLC lowered its stake in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FTFree Report) by 3.2% in the 1st quarter, Holdings Channel.com reports. The firm owned 52,508 shares of the software giant’s stock after selling 1,739 shares during the period. Microsoft makes up 5.8% of Leeward Financial Partners LLC’s holdings, making the stock its biggest holding. Leeward Financial Partners LLC’s holdings in Microsoft were worth $19,437,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

Microsoft Trading Up 3.0%

Microsoft stock opened at $384.28 on Thursday. Microsoft Corporation has a 52-week low of $349.20 and a 52-week high of $555.45. The company has a quick ratio of 1.27, a current ratio of 1.28 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.08. The firm has a market capitalization of $2.85 trillion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 22.87, a PEG ratio of 1.34 and a beta of 1.13. The firm has a 50-day moving average price of $407.66 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$418.67.

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FTG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 29th. The software giant reported $4.27 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$4.06 by $0.21. The company had revenue of $82.89 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$81.44 billion. Microsoft had a net margin of 39.34% and a return on equity of 31.94%. Microsoft’s revenue was up 18.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$3.46 earnings per share. Sell-side analysts expect that Microsoft Corporation will post 16.76 earnings per share for the current year.

Microsoft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 10th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, August 20th will be paid a dividend of $0.91 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, August 20th. This represents a $3.64 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.9%. Microsoft’s payout ratio is presently 21.67%.

About Microsoft

(Free Report)

Microsoft Corporation is a global technology company headquartered in Redmond, Washington. Founded in 1975 by Bill Gates and Paul Allen, Microsoft develops, licenses and supports a broad range of software products, services and devices for consumers, enterprises and governments worldwide. Its operations span personal computing, productivity software, cloud infrastructure, enterprise applications, developer tools and gaming.

Microsoft’s product portfolio includes the Windows operating system and the Microsoft 365 suite of productivity and collaboration tools (Office apps, Outlook, Teams).
